One thing you can do to buy some extra time is set up a payment arrangement. They work, only thing is you have to make sure you pay them when you say you will. If you don’t they won’t let you set up another payment arrangement and you might find yourself sitting in the dark.
Another thing is paying by check, normally it takes at least 3 days for that pay by phone system thing to reach your bank. So if you have direct deposit you’re good until Friday. Also you can try to get them to move your due date. I find it that most of my bills are due on the same date. So if you can’t pay your cable b/c your lights are due, or the hot water gets cut off b/c it’s rent time. Call up one of these wealthy companies who act like your hundred dollars is going to break their business, and ask them to move your due date.
